Taken with Canon 50mm 1.8 II on Worthing Beach, Sussex, England.

Editing.

-Removed saturation from all colours except megenta.
-Brightened and Increased megenta saturation.
-Unsharp mask.
-Resized.

I like the portrait an sich and the partial desaturation works well here. But there is a bit too much space around her and the composition is to centered. A 5x4 crop might bring a better balance. I think I'd loose some of the space on the left, she needs the space at the right to look into.
